+FmDriverInfo FmUtils::queryDriverInfo( const QString &driverName )
+{
+    quint64 size = 0;
+    quint64 freeSize = 0;
+    QString driver = driverName;
+    
+    driver.replace( '/', "\\" );
+    if ( driver.right(1) != "\\" ) {
+        driver.append( "\\" );
+    }
+    GetDiskFreeSpaceEx( (LPCWSTR)driver.constData(),
+                        (PULARGE_INTEGER)&freeSize,
+                        (PULARGE_INTEGER)&size,
+                        0 );
+
+    TCHAR volumeName[MAX_PATH + 1] = { 0 };
+    GetVolumeInformation( (LPCWSTR)driver.constData(),
+                          &volumeName[0],
+                          MAX_PATH + 1,
+                          0,
+                          0,
+                          0,
+                          0,
+                          0 );
+
+    return FmDriverInfo( size, freeSize, driverName, QString::fromWCharArray( &volumeName[0] ) );
+}

+quint32 FmUtils::getDriverState( const QString &driverName )
+{
+    quint32 state( 0 );
+
+    QString driver = driverName;
+    
+    driver.replace( '/', "\\" );
+    if ( driver.right(1) != "\\" ) {
+        driver.append( "\\" );
+    }
+
+    quint32 drvStatus = GetDriveType( (LPCWSTR)driver.constData() );
+
+    if ( drvStatus == DRIVE_REMOVABLE  ) {
+        state |= FmDriverInfo::EDriveRemovable;
+    }
+
+    return state;
+
+}
